Tuscon energy facility to be shut down by October

by Administrator 17. August 2011 01:38

A German solar panel company has announced that the Tuscon plant will be shut down. This closure will cost 60 employees their jobs and officials have said that the cut backs do not end there.

The company Solon SE will also be laying off people at the Berlin Headquarters, mostly in the administrative department. The company has reportedly been struggling to make revenue and in the first half of 2011, they reported a loss of nearly $91 million. The company is now leaving the U.S. solar panel industry and will be refocusing their efforts elsewhere.
